CAMPAIGN BRIEF

01 // CAMPAIGN BRIEF

Between 2024 and 2026, units of Ukraine's Defence Forces armed with RAM-family loitering munitions struck thousands of enemy targets. One class of target stood apart: the invaders' air defence. Launchers, search and guidance radars, transloaders, battalion command posts.

Dozens of units did this work with several different weapons. Our part of it is more than 410 confirmed strikes on air-defence targets, every one of them captured on video.

Now we are presenting RAM by Ukrspecsystems to the public.

02 // WHY WE STAYED SILENT

Strike footage gives away how a weapon works: its range, how it behaves in the terminal phase, how it holds its link, how long it needs to reach the target. As long as the enemy did not know whose drone this was, or how it approached, the next mission could repeat the last one. That is why we never captioned a single frame.

Today the enemy keeps its own count of these strikes and has worked out the method from the results. Silence no longer protects anything.

ONLY FOOTAGE THAT HAS LOST ITS COMBAT VALUE GOES INTO THE ARCHIVE. ONGOING MISSIONS STAY CLOSED.

TARGET Command-and-staff vehicle from the S-300P system
TARGET CLASS Air defense
SYSTEM RAM-2X
UNIT 15 Brigade "Black Forest"
PERIOD Summer 2026
A good example of the “killer duo” at work. SHARK-M first detected the S-300P command vehicle and remained over the area, tracking it and passing updated coordinates to RAM-2X. After the strike, the reconnaissance UAV stayed long enough to record the result and then safely left the area with footage for battle-damage assessment. One aircraft found and observed the target; the other completed the engagement.
TARGET Buk-M3
TARGET CLASS AIR DEFENSE
SYSTEM Black Betty
UNIT 15 Brigade "Black Forest
PERIOD Spring 2025
This Buk-M3 was not caught parked or inactive. It was found in working configuration and apparently already engaging aerial threats — only one missile remained on the launcher. Despite being designed to detect and engage fast aerial targets at significant range, the system was first located by a reconnaissance asset and then approached by Black Betty. The operator placed the strike directly into the radar section, hitting the component the Buk relies on to detect and track threats.
TARGET P-18 TEREK RADAR
TARGET CLASS RADAR / AIR DEFENSE
SYSTEM RAM-2X
UNIT ███
PERIOD Summer 2026
The crew had chosen the position carefully. The radar was placed inside a caponier and additional cover was being installed around it, leaving only limited access to the equipment. The problem was the antenna: large enough to compromise an otherwise well-protected position. RAM-2X approached through the remaining opening in the cover and was guided directly into the radar’s main components.
TARGET S-400 TRIUMF LAUNCHER
TARGET CLASS AIR DEFENSE
SYSTEM RAM-2X
UNIT 413th Separate Regiment «RAID»
PERIOD Summer 2026
One of the rarest and most valuable targets in Russian air defence. The engagement took place at night, with the S-400 already deployed and operating. RAM-2X approached the system in the terminal phase and was guided into its most critical component — the launch containers. The strike triggered a secondary detonation and ammunition cook-off, turning a precision hit into the destruction of the launcher.
TARGET 2S6 TUNGUSKA
TARGET CLASS AIR DEFENSE
SYSTEM RAM-2X
UNIT ███
PERIOD Spring 2024
This Tunguska was hiding among buildings and trees, using the terrain to make aerial detection difficult. That worked until the position was identified. Instead of approaching across the open ground, RAM-2X comes in toward the concealed vehicle, with the target becoming clearly visible only in the final part of the engagement. A close-range air-defence system designed to stop low-flying threats gets very little warning of one arriving.
TARGET NEBO-U RADAR
TARGET CLASS RADAR / AIR DEFENSE
SYSTEM RAM-2X
UNIT 429th Brigade “ACHILLES”
PERIOD Summer 2026
This long-range three-coordinate radar was positioned at an airfield in Russia’s Rostov region, where it helped provide early warning and protection for aircraft operating from the base. The target was engaged at a distance of roughly 170 km. RAM-2X reached the airfield and struck the radar, reducing the enemy’s ability to detect approaching aerial threats in time.
TARGET BUK-M2
TARGET CLASS AIR DEFENSE
SYSTEM RAM-2X
UNIT SSU
PERIOD Spring 2024
Mobile air defence survives by refusing to stay where it was last seen. This Buk-M2 was detected during the period between relocation and concealment, leaving a narrow window to complete the engagement. By the time RAM-2X reached the area, the challenge was no longer simply reaching the coordinates — it was finding and confirming the vehicle before the opportunity disappeared. The footage shows that final search and approach, ending with the Buk itself in the centre of the frame.
TARGET NEBO-SVU RADAR
TARGET CLASS RADAR / AIR DEFENSE
SYSTEM RAM-2X
UNIT ███
PERIOD Spring 2025
This Nebo-SVU long-range radar system normally spent most of its time hidden inside a heavily protected underground shelter. SHARK-M tracked the position and waited for the short window when the vehicle emerged but had not yet fully deployed. That was the moment the strike was initiated. RAM-2X was launched while SHARK-M remained in the area as a communications relay, supporting the engagement through to the target. According to the assessed result, the strike caused approximately $100 million in damage.

THE RAM FAMILY OF
LOITERING MUNITIONS

RAM-2X

RAM / 2X

Operational-tactical loitering munition

RANGE 180 km
CRUISE SPEED 80 km/h
FLIGHT TIME 2 h 15 min
WARHEAD 3.5 kg
  • Locks on and tracks the target automatically from 3 km
  • Optical navigation and AI recognition of vehicles
  • Silvus, DTC and Starlink links; relay through PD-2, Shark-D, Shark-M
  • Hits chosen parts of the target, approach angle up to 40°
  • Counter-interception system
